|
Retailer | Price | |
---|---|---|
Hotels | £0.00 | Go to shop |
This 3 star hotel is located on the coastline of Mykonos and was established in 1986. It is a short drive away from the Delos Island. The Hotel has an outdoor swimming pool. All 27 rooms are equipped with air conditioning.
Tucked away in green rolling hills, the Hotel S'Olia offers an idyllic getaway in the wonderful countryside of Sardinia. The romantic rooms feature a harmonious country house style and either have a nice balcony or large windows. At the hotel’s restaurant...
|